Top Health In Manali | Reviews & Ratings | comparemela.com

Health in manali in India - 175103/ near manali/ near kullu

Health in manali in India - 175131/ near manali/ near kullu

Health in manali in India - 175103/ near manali/ near kullu

Health in manali in India - 175131/ near manali/ near kullu

Health in manali in India - 175143/ near manali/ near kullu

Health in manali in India - 175131/ near manali/ near kullu

Health in manali in India - 175103/ near manali/ near kullu

Health in manali in India - 175131/ near manali/ near kullu